Compare commits

...

7 Commits

5 changed files with 15 additions and 15 deletions
+1 -1
View File
@@ -4,7 +4,7 @@
<option name="proxyHost" value="192.168.123.88" />
<option name="proxyPassword" value="123" />
<option name="proxyPort" value="7890" />
<option name="proxyType" value="HTTP" />
<option name="proxyType" value="DIRECT" />
<option name="proxyUsername" value="123" />
<option name="readTimeout" value="120" />
</component>
+1 -1
View File
@@ -1,5 +1,5 @@
<application>
<component name="CodeGPT_CustomServicesSettings">
<option name="services" value="[{&quot;id&quot;:&quot;4f24dc7f-3b57-4b87-b0ad-54b262916ae7&quot;,&quot;url&quot;:null,&quot;contextWindowSize&quot;:200000,&quot;template&quot;:&quot;OPEN_ROUTER&quot;,&quot;body&quot;:{},&quot;chatCompletionSettings&quot;:{&quot;url&quot;:&quot;https://api.siliconflow.cn/v1/completions&quot;,&quot;body&quot;:{&quot;stream&quot;:true,&quot;model&quot;:&quot;meta-llama/llama-3.1-8b-instruct:free&quot;,&quot;messages&quot;:&quot;$OPENAI_MESSAGES&quot;,&quot;temperature&quot;:0.1,&quot;max_tokens&quot;:8192},&quot;headers&quot;:{&quot;X-LLM-Application-Tag&quot;:&quot;proxyai&quot;,&quot;Authorization&quot;:&quot;Bearer $CUSTOM_SERVICE_API_KEY&quot;,&quot;HTTP-Referer&quot;:&quot;https://tryproxy.io&quot;,&quot;X-Title&quot;:&quot;ProxyAI&quot;,&quot;Content-Type&quot;:&quot;application/json&quot;},&quot;modificationCount&quot;:21,&quot;equalToDefault&quot;:false},&quot;codeCompletionSettings&quot;:{&quot;url&quot;:&quot;https://api.siliconflow.cn/v1/completions&quot;,&quot;codeCompletionsEnabled&quot;:false,&quot;parseResponseAsChatCompletions&quot;:false,&quot;infillTemplate&quot;:&quot;CODE_QWEN_2_5&quot;,&quot;body&quot;:{&quot;suffix&quot;:&quot;$SUFFIX&quot;,&quot;stream&quot;:true,&quot;model&quot;:&quot;Qwen/Qwen3-Coder-30B-A3B-Instruct&quot;,&quot;temperature&quot;:0.1,&quot;prompt&quot;:&quot;$PREFIX&quot;,&quot;max_tokens&quot;:128},&quot;headers&quot;:{&quot;Authorization&quot;:&quot;Bearer $CUSTOM_SERVICE_API_KEY&quot;,&quot;X-LLM-Application-Tag&quot;:&quot;proxyai&quot;,&quot;Content-Type&quot;:&quot;application/json&quot;},&quot;modificationCount&quot;:20,&quot;equalToDefault&quot;:false},&quot;name&quot;:&quot;CodeCompletion&quot;,&quot;headers&quot;:{},&quot;modificationCount&quot;:61,&quot;equalToDefault&quot;:false},{&quot;id&quot;:&quot;cfdf9454-a195-4ff9-afcc-55536dd49506&quot;,&quot;url&quot;:null,&quot;contextWindowSize&quot;:200000,&quot;template&quot;:&quot;OPEN_ROUTER&quot;,&quot;body&quot;:{},&quot;chatCompletionSettings&quot;:{&quot;url&quot;:&quot;https://openrouter.ai/api/v1/chat/completions&quot;,&quot;body&quot;:{&quot;stream&quot;:true,&quot;model&quot;:&quot;google/gemini-3.1-pro-preview&quot;,&quot;messages&quot;:&quot;$OPENAI_MESSAGES&quot;,&quot;temperature&quot;:0.1,&quot;max_tokens&quot;:16384},&quot;headers&quot;:{&quot;X-LLM-Application-Tag&quot;:&quot;proxyai&quot;,&quot;Authorization&quot;:&quot;Bearer $CUSTOM_SERVICE_API_KEY&quot;,&quot;HTTP-Referer&quot;:&quot;https://tryproxy.io&quot;,&quot;X-Title&quot;:&quot;ProxyAI&quot;,&quot;Content-Type&quot;:&quot;application/json&quot;},&quot;modificationCount&quot;:21,&quot;equalToDefault&quot;:false},&quot;codeCompletionSettings&quot;:{&quot;url&quot;:&quot;https://openrouter.ai/api/v1/chat/completions&quot;,&quot;codeCompletionsEnabled&quot;:false,&quot;parseResponseAsChatCompletions&quot;:false,&quot;infillTemplate&quot;:&quot;OPENAI&quot;,&quot;body&quot;:{&quot;suffix&quot;:&quot;$SUFFIX&quot;,&quot;stream&quot;:true,&quot;model&quot;:&quot;google/gemini-3.1-pro-preview&quot;,&quot;temperature&quot;:0.2,&quot;prompt&quot;:&quot;$PREFIX&quot;,&quot;max_tokens&quot;:24},&quot;headers&quot;:{&quot;Authorization&quot;:&quot;Bearer $CUSTOM_SERVICE_API_KEY&quot;,&quot;X-LLM-Application-Tag&quot;:&quot;proxyai&quot;,&quot;Content-Type&quot;:&quot;application/json&quot;},&quot;modificationCount&quot;:19,&quot;equalToDefault&quot;:false},&quot;name&quot;:&quot;ORChat&quot;,&quot;headers&quot;:{},&quot;modificationCount&quot;:60,&quot;equalToDefault&quot;:false}]" />
<option name="services" value="[{&quot;id&quot;:&quot;f2db8cef-49a2-477c-a6ec-009e7d52c840&quot;,&quot;url&quot;:null,&quot;template&quot;:&quot;OPENAI&quot;,&quot;contextWindowSize&quot;:200000,&quot;chatCompletionSettings&quot;:{&quot;url&quot;:&quot;https://lingzhi.agibot.com/v1/chat/completions&quot;,&quot;body&quot;:{&quot;stream&quot;:true,&quot;model&quot;:&quot;gpt-5.4&quot;,&quot;max_tokens&quot;:8192},&quot;headers&quot;:{&quot;Authorization&quot;:&quot;Bearer $CUSTOM_SERVICE_API_KEY&quot;,&quot;X-LLM-Application-Tag&quot;:&quot;proxyai&quot;,&quot;Content-Type&quot;:&quot;application/json&quot;},&quot;modificationCount&quot;:12,&quot;equalToDefault&quot;:false},&quot;codeCompletionSettings&quot;:{&quot;url&quot;:&quot;https://lingzhi.agibot.com/v1/chat/completions&quot;,&quot;parseResponseAsChatCompletions&quot;:true,&quot;infillTemplate&quot;:&quot;CHAT_COMPLETION&quot;,&quot;body&quot;:{&quot;suffix&quot;:&quot;$SUFFIX&quot;,&quot;model&quot;:&quot;gpt-5.4&quot;,&quot;temperature&quot;:0.1,&quot;prompt&quot;:&quot;$PREFIX&quot;,&quot;max_tokens&quot;:256},&quot;codeCompletionsEnabled&quot;:true,&quot;headers&quot;:{&quot;Authorization&quot;:&quot;Bearer $CUSTOM_SERVICE_API_KEY&quot;,&quot;X-LLM-Application-Tag&quot;:&quot;proxyai&quot;,&quot;Content-Type&quot;:&quot;application/json&quot;},&quot;modificationCount&quot;:23,&quot;equalToDefault&quot;:false},&quot;body&quot;:{},&quot;name&quot;:&quot;lz&quot;,&quot;headers&quot;:{},&quot;modificationCount&quot;:54,&quot;equalToDefault&quot;:false}]" />
</component>
</application>
+8 -8
View File
@@ -5,7 +5,7 @@
<entry key="AGENT">
<value>
<ModelDetailsState>
<option name="model" value="cfdf9454-a195-4ff9-afcc-55536dd49506" />
<option name="model" value="f2db8cef-49a2-477c-a6ec-009e7d52c840" />
<option name="provider" value="Custom OpenAI" />
</ModelDetailsState>
</value>
@@ -13,7 +13,7 @@
<entry key="AUTO_APPLY">
<value>
<ModelDetailsState>
<option name="model" value="cfdf9454-a195-4ff9-afcc-55536dd49506" />
<option name="model" value="f2db8cef-49a2-477c-a6ec-009e7d52c840" />
<option name="provider" value="Custom OpenAI" />
</ModelDetailsState>
</value>
@@ -21,7 +21,7 @@
<entry key="CHAT">
<value>
<ModelDetailsState>
<option name="model" value="cfdf9454-a195-4ff9-afcc-55536dd49506" />
<option name="model" value="f2db8cef-49a2-477c-a6ec-009e7d52c840" />
<option name="provider" value="Custom OpenAI" />
</ModelDetailsState>
</value>
@@ -29,7 +29,7 @@
<entry key="CODE_COMPLETION">
<value>
<ModelDetailsState>
<option name="model" value="4f24dc7f-3b57-4b87-b0ad-54b262916ae7" />
<option name="model" value="f2db8cef-49a2-477c-a6ec-009e7d52c840" />
<option name="provider" value="Custom OpenAI" />
</ModelDetailsState>
</value>
@@ -37,7 +37,7 @@
<entry key="COMMIT_MESSAGE">
<value>
<ModelDetailsState>
<option name="model" value="cfdf9454-a195-4ff9-afcc-55536dd49506" />
<option name="model" value="f2db8cef-49a2-477c-a6ec-009e7d52c840" />
<option name="provider" value="Custom OpenAI" />
</ModelDetailsState>
</value>
@@ -45,7 +45,7 @@
<entry key="INLINE_EDIT">
<value>
<ModelDetailsState>
<option name="model" value="cfdf9454-a195-4ff9-afcc-55536dd49506" />
<option name="model" value="f2db8cef-49a2-477c-a6ec-009e7d52c840" />
<option name="provider" value="Custom OpenAI" />
</ModelDetailsState>
</value>
@@ -53,7 +53,7 @@
<entry key="LOOKUP">
<value>
<ModelDetailsState>
<option name="model" value="cfdf9454-a195-4ff9-afcc-55536dd49506" />
<option name="model" value="f2db8cef-49a2-477c-a6ec-009e7d52c840" />
<option name="provider" value="Custom OpenAI" />
</ModelDetailsState>
</value>
@@ -61,7 +61,7 @@
<entry key="NEXT_EDIT">
<value>
<ModelDetailsState>
<option name="model" value="mercury-coder" />
<option name="model" value="mercury-edit-2" />
<option name="provider" value="ProxyAI" />
</ModelDetailsState>
</value>
+1 -1
View File
@@ -30,7 +30,7 @@
<jdk version="2">
<name value="jbr-21" />
<type value="JavaSDK" />
<version value="JetBrains Runtime 21.0.9" />
<version value="JetBrains Runtime 21.0.10" />
<homePath value="$APPLICATION_HOME_DIR$/jbr" />
<roots>
<annotationsPath>
+4 -4
View File
@@ -1,6 +1,6 @@
<application>
<component name="Translation.Cache">
<option name="lastTrimTime" value="1776780651130" />
<option name="lastTrimTime" value="1777277581954" />
</component>
<component name="Translation.OpenAISettings">
<option name="OPEN_AI">
@@ -17,11 +17,13 @@
<option name="translator" value="OPEN_AI" />
</component>
<component name="Translation.States">
<option name="translationDialogHeight" value="260" />
<option name="translationDialogHeight" value="325" />
<option name="translationDialogLocationX" value="2705" />
<option name="translationDialogLocationY" value="567" />
<option name="translationDialogWidth" value="1381" />
<histories>
<item value="Whether the decoration is the same size as the input field. A collapsed decoration cannot have [labelText], [errorText], [counter], [icon], prefixes, and suffixes. To create a collapsed input decoration, use [InputDecoration.collapsed]." />
<item value="is 4 D joystick" />
<item value="The application is not currently visible to the user, and not responding to user input. When the application is in this state, the engine will not call the [PlatformDispatcher.onBeginFrame] and [PlatformDispatcher.onDrawFrame] callbacks. This state is only entered on iOS and Android." />
<item value="All views of an application are hidden, either because the application is about to be paused (on iOS and Android), or because it has been minimized or placed on a desktop that is no longer visible (on non-web desktop), or is running in a window or tab that is no longer visible (on the web). On iOS and Android, in order to keep the state machine the same on all platforms, a transition to this state is synthesized before the [paused] state is entered when coming from [inactive], and before the [inactive] state is entered when coming from [paused]. This allows cross-platform implementations that want to know when an app is conceptually &quot;hidden&quot; to only write one handler." />
<item value="On Android and iOS, apps in this state should assume that they may be [hidden] and [paused] at any time." />
@@ -70,8 +72,6 @@
<item value="center" />
<item value="This example includes a generic `SpinnerField&lt;T&gt;` class that you can copy into your own project and customize." />
<item value="This example includes a generic `SpinnerFie into your own project and customize." />
<item value="{@macro flutter.widgets.editableText.onTapOutside} {@tool dartpad} This example shows how to use a `TextFieldTapRegion` to wrap a set of &quot;spinner&quot; buttons that increment and decrement a value in the [TextField] without causing the text field to lose keyboard focus." />
<item value="The number of discrete divisions. Typically used with [label] to show the current discrete value. If null, the slider is continuous." />
</histories>
<option name="languageScores">
<map>